unofficial mirror of help-gnu-emacs@gnu.org
 help / color / mirror / Atom feed
* understanding emacs packages
@ 2007-10-03 12:14 knubee
  2007-10-03 13:46 ` Joel J. Adamson
  0 siblings, 1 reply; 12+ messages in thread
From: knubee @ 2007-10-03 12:14 UTC (permalink / raw)
  To: help-gnu-emacs

This seems like it may be a faq, but I could not find the answer.

When I upgrade my gnu/linux distribution and re-install various emacs
applications, it is not always clear to me what is the cause of an
error when I run an emacs application. As an example, there may be
some oddness inserting dates in org-mode. No errors, but failure to do
things.

This could be because the gnu/linux distro is still in beta (e.g.,
ubuntu gutsy), it could be because I have  not installed all the
necessary emacs packages, or it could be because there non-emacs code/
application that is necessary.

So that is my question: how do different approaches to installing
emacs packages interact with packages in the existing emacs
distribution -- and interact with non-elisp applications?

Example: in the synaptic package manager, there is a "planner" package
and a "planner-el" package. When I select "planner-el" for
installation and "planner" is not required/suggested.

- Does this mean that "planner-el" is an elisp implementation of
"planner"?

- If so, are there cases where there is a "foo-el" package that relies
on a "foo" (non-elisp) application. In other words, can a situation
arise when I am using an application in emacs and it exhibits odd
behavior  because a non-emacs  application needs to be installed? If
so, is it always obvious?

And is there a straightforward way to tell if some package is already
part of the emacs distribution I am using (so that I do  not attempt
to download/install it myself)?

thanks for any help/pointers.

^ permalink raw reply	[flat|nested] 12+ messages in thread

end of thread, other threads:[~2007-10-08  3:18 UTC | newest]

Thread overview: 12+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2007-10-03 12:14 understanding emacs packages knubee
2007-10-03 13:46 ` Joel J. Adamson
2007-10-03 14:05   ` knubee
2007-10-03 15:40     ` Joel J. Adamson
2007-10-03 23:23       ` knubee
2007-10-03 18:36     ` Seweryn Kokot
2007-10-04  9:35     ` Tim X
2007-10-07  4:38       ` knubee
2007-10-07 19:21         ` Eli Zaretskii
     [not found]         ` <mailman.1808.1191784883.18990.help-gnu-emacs@gnu.org>
2007-10-07 21:48           ` knubee
2007-10-08  3:18             ` Tim X
2007-10-08  3:01         ` Tim X

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).